Candidates need not come to the Board's Headquarters or State Offices to lodge any complaints. All complaints could be conveniently lodged on support.jamb.gov.ng . This is a ticketing platform where all complaints are lodged and treated by the Board.      All complaints lodged on the ticketing platform are treated promptly. Please do not travel to the Board's headquarters, offices for what you can do at a more convenient ticketing platform.

Prof. Is-haq Olarewaju Oloyede was born in October 1954. He hails from Abeokuta South Local Government Area of Ogun State. He had his Secondary Education from 1969-1973 at the Progressive Institute, Agege Lagos and Arabic Training Centre Agege, Lagos, (Markaz) from 1973-1976 and later to the University of Ibadan between 1976 and 1977 where he obtained a certificate in Arabic and Islamic Studies. The legal instrument establishing the Board was promulgated by the Act (No. 2 of 1978) of the Federal Military Government on 13th February, 1978. By August 1988, the Federal Executive Council amended Decree No. 2 of 1978. The amendments have since been codified into Decree No. 33 of 1989, which took effect from 7th December, 1989.
